Master Healthcare Quality Measurement

Healthcare quality measurement is a cornerstone of modern healthcare, providing essential insights into the effectiveness, safety, and efficiency of medical services. It involves systematically evaluating the processes, structures, and outcomes of healthcare delivery against established standards to identify areas for improvement. Effective healthcare quality measurement directly impacts patient safety, satisfaction, and overall public health, making it an indispensable practice for all healthcare providers and organizations.

Key Dimensions of Healthcare Quality

To comprehensively assess healthcare quality, various dimensions are typically considered, ensuring a holistic view of care delivery. These dimensions provide a framework for robust healthcare quality measurement.

  • Safety: Avoiding injuries to patients from the care that is intended to help them.

  • Effectiveness: Providing services based on scientific knowledge to all who could benefit, and refraining from providing services to those not likely to benefit (avoiding underuse and overuse).

  • Patient-Centeredness: Providing care that is respectful of and responsive to individual patient preferences, needs, and values, and ensuring that patient values guide all clinical decisions.

  • Timeliness: Reducing waits and harmful delays for both those who receive and those who give care.

  • Efficiency: Avoiding waste, including waste of equipment, supplies, ideas, and energy.

  • Equity: Providing care that does not vary in quality because of personal characteristics such as gender, ethnicity, geographic location, and socioeconomic status.

Types of Healthcare Quality Measures

Various types of measures are employed in healthcare quality measurement, each offering a different perspective on care delivery. Understanding these categories is essential for comprehensive evaluation.

Structure Measures

Structure measures assess the characteristics of the healthcare setting, such as facilities, equipment, technology, and staffing levels. These measures provide insight into the capacity and organizational characteristics that support quality care. For instance, the presence of an electronic health record system or the ratio of nurses to patients are examples of structure measures relevant to healthcare quality measurement.

Process Measures

Process measures evaluate the activities involved in delivering healthcare, focusing on how care is provided. These measures often reflect adherence to clinical guidelines or best practices. Examples include the percentage of patients receiving recommended vaccinations, the timeliness of antibiotic administration for pneumonia, or screening rates for chronic diseases. Process measures are crucial for understanding the steps taken to achieve good outcomes in healthcare quality measurement.

Outcome Measures

Outcome measures reflect the impact of healthcare services on a patient’s health status. These are often considered the most important measures, as they directly indicate the effectiveness of care. Examples include mortality rates, readmission rates, infection rates, or patient functional status after surgery. Effective healthcare quality measurement heavily relies on accurately tracking and analyzing outcome data.

Patient Experience Measures

Patient experience measures capture patients’ perceptions of the care they received. These measures often involve surveys or feedback mechanisms to assess aspects like communication with providers, pain management, and overall hospital environment. Including patient experience in healthcare quality measurement ensures that care is not only clinically effective but also compassionate and responsive to individual needs.

Challenges in Healthcare Quality Measurement

Despite its critical importance, healthcare quality measurement faces several inherent challenges that organizations must navigate. These complexities can impact the accuracy and utility of the data collected.

Common challenges include:

  • Data Collection and Availability: Obtaining consistent, accurate, and complete data across diverse healthcare settings can be difficult due to varying record-keeping systems and data silos.

  • Standardization Issues: Lack of universal standards for defining and collecting certain quality metrics can lead to inconsistencies and make comparisons challenging.

  • Risk Adjustment: Patients have varying health complexities. Adjusting measures for patient risk factors is crucial to ensure fair comparisons between providers, but this can be complex.

  • Attribution: It can be difficult to attribute specific outcomes to a single provider or intervention, especially in cases of chronic conditions or complex care pathways.

  • Overburdening Providers: The administrative burden of data collection for healthcare quality measurement can divert resources from direct patient care.

Implementing Effective Healthcare Quality Measurement

To overcome these challenges and harness the full potential of healthcare quality measurement, organizations should adopt strategic approaches. Implementing effective measurement strategies requires careful planning and commitment.

Best practices for implementing effective healthcare quality measurement include:

  • Define Clear Objectives: Clearly articulate what aspects of quality are being measured and why, aligning with organizational goals and patient needs.

  • Select Relevant Measures: Choose a balanced set of structure, process, outcome, and patient experience measures that are valid, reliable, and actionable.

  • Leverage Technology: Utilize electronic health records (EHRs), data analytics platforms, and other digital tools to automate data collection, reduce manual effort, and improve accuracy in healthcare quality measurement.

  • Engage Stakeholders: Involve clinicians, administrators, patients, and other stakeholders in the design and implementation of quality measurement initiatives to foster buy-in and ensure relevance.

  • Promote Transparency: Share quality data internally and, where appropriate, externally to drive accountability and encourage continuous improvement.

  • Foster a Culture of Quality: Embed a commitment to quality improvement throughout the organization, encouraging learning from data and adapting practices based on insights from healthcare quality measurement.

The Future of Healthcare Quality Measurement

The field of healthcare quality measurement is continually evolving, driven by technological advancements and shifts towards value-based care models. Future trends will likely include greater integration of real-time data, the use of artificial intelligence and machine learning for predictive analytics, and an increased focus on patient-reported outcome measures (PROMs).

As healthcare systems become more interconnected, the ability to collect, analyze, and act upon comprehensive healthcare quality measurement data will be even more critical. This evolution promises to make quality assessment more precise, proactive, and ultimately more beneficial for patients.
